Carigara town in Leyte placed under state of calamity
The municipality of Carigara in Leyte has been placed under a state of calamity due to Tropical Depression Urduja.
The Carigara Municipal Disaster Risk Reduction and Management Council said town was placed under a state of calamity on Saturday due to "risks and damages brought upon by Urduja."
Carigara is the third municipality in Eastern Visayas to be placed under a state of calamity.
Tacloban and Ormoc cities made separate declarations due to damages wrought by the cyclone.
Urduja slammed into Eastern Samar on Saturday afternoon and cross Samar provinces until early Sunday.
Weather bureau PAGASA said in its 11 a.m. bulletin that Urduja has moved over Masbate.
The cyclone is expected to pass Palawan and stay near the province before its expected exit from the Philippine Area of Responsibility on Wednesday. —ALG, GMA News
